diff --git a/index.js b/index.js index 5897d71..84a3e7c 100644 --- a/index.js +++ b/index.js @@ -580,11 +580,11 @@ class ServerlessAmplifyPlugin { * @param {String} contents the contents of the file */ writeConfigurationFile(filename, contents) { - fs.writeFile(filename, contents, 'utf8', (err, data) => { - if (err) { - this.log('error', `Writing to ${filename}: ${err}`); - } - }); + try { + fs.writeFileSync(filename, contents, 'utf8'); + } catch (err) { + this.log('error', `Writing to ${filename}: ${err}`); + } } }